The Wine: CLARIS Pinot Grigio 2010 is produced by Terre Gaie (Happy Lands) located in the village of Vo’ Euganeo in the hilly Colli Euganei region halfway between Palova and Vicenza in central Veneto, Italy.

In Latin,CLARIS means clarity and purity.

Complex body,floral and minerality standout out with every sip.

Layers of flavors,full-body and the refreshing minerality on the tip of the tongue are the first sensations and tastes you notice. The delicate layers of citrus and stone fruit (I taste PEACH and APRICOT), the floral nose and detectable chalky minerality are both clean and crisp,and is therefore true to this wine’s name.

Pairing with this mussel dish was right on target!

The floral and earthy minerality was a great match with the briny shellfish and broth,fresh lemon zest and earthy saffron and fennel.

Pinot Grigio is typically a very versatile pairing wine.

Savory dishes of pork,chicken and spices as well as creamy cheeses would also be a great match for CLARIS.

Recipe:
2 to 3 pounds  each of mussels and clams
1 pound fresh shrimp,in shell
3 Calamari tubes and tentacles-tubes sliced into rings
1 filet of fresh fish such as halibut or any other firm white fish,chopped into bite-sized pieces
3 links of Italian Sausage-cooked and sliced
1/2 cup olive oil
1 onion,chopped
1 large juicy tomato,chopped
5 garlic cloves,minced
Fresh Fennel, 1 cup diced
1 fresh lemon,zested and juiced
2 spicy peppers-your choice-minced
1 small package of Saffron Threads
Chicken broth or Seafood Stock-about 1 cup Keep extra around,you may need it
***White Wine-about 3/4 cup
Dried Thyme-1 heaping teaspoonful or more-I love the intense,earthy flavor of dried thyme
salt/pepper to taste

***My thoughts on Wine to Cook With:
There are many thoughts and opinions of wines to use with your recipes. What have found that works well with me is keeping a “stock bottle” of a Sauvignon Blanc in the refrigerator. Choose one that tastes good enough to drink but not so expensive that you feel guilty cooking with it. Sauvignon Blanc is light,citrusy and acidic and it perfect for recipes like this one,where you need a tangy,lively broth to complement the seafood as well as the CLARIS Pinot Grigio. Diced Fresh Fennel adds a flavorful rustic and earthiness to this dish and is further enhanced by the intense fennel flavor from the seeds in the sausage.


Saffron is probably my favorite spice. It adds an earthy floral and rustic component and subtle hay aromas as well as a beautiful golden yellow color to the seafood broth.


Saute’ the chopped vegetables(all except the tomato) together in olive oil until tender, adding the herbs and spices as you stir.


Add the wine and broth to the vegetable sauté and reduce.


Gently add the seafood to the pan tossing in the sliced sausage and chopped tomato. Simmer with the lid on until the mussels and clams are opened and the shrimp are pink.

During the cooking process,add more broth if needed.

Serve with thick slices of Ciabatta Bread slathered in olive oil and grilled in a grill pan until crisp.
